Furious Roberto De Zerbi Vows Never to Coach in France Again
After a devastating 3-0 loss against Auxerre, Marseille’s head coach Roberto De Zerbi expressed his frustration with what he described as ‘scandalous’ refereeing in the match. De Zerbi’s outburst came after a series of controversial decisions by the officials that ultimately led to Marseille’s defeat.
Controversial Match Against Auxerre
The match between Marseille and Auxerre was filled with drama from the start. Auxerre took an early lead, putting Marseille on the back foot. However, it was the refereeing decisions that truly incensed De Zerbi and the Marseille team.
Throughout the game, De Zerbi was seen arguing with the officials over a number of contentious calls, including a penalty decision that went against Marseille. The frustration continued to boil over as Auxerre capitalized on their opportunities and ultimately secured a 3-0 victory.
‘Scandalous’ Refereeing
Following the match, De Zerbi did not hold back in his criticism of the refereeing decisions. He called the officiating ‘scandalous’ and expressed his disbelief at some of the calls made during the game. De Zerbi’s anger was palpable as he vowed never to coach in France again after this experience.
Marseille’s president also joined in the condemnation of the Ligue 1 officials, echoing De Zerbi’s sentiments about the quality of refereeing in French football.
